Selection and verification

Convert cycle speed into accepted product output

A cycle-rate claim does not establish capacity. Smaller 1–10 mm settings may change blade loading and fines, while thicker portions change the number of finished pieces per block. Define the percentage of output that must remain inside dimensional tolerance.

Resolve the loading envelope

Provide minimum and maximum block length, width and thickness plus photographs. Ask the factory to mark the usable inlet and active knife width on the general-arrangement drawing.

Temperature control

Measure surface and core temperatures at loading. A warm surface can smear while a colder core increases cutting force, causing dimensional variation even when the positioning system repeats accurately.

Cleaning procedure

Lock out power before accessing belts, guides or cutters. Include the upper belt, lower return, discharge conveyor, guard interfaces and internal seams in sanitation verification. Record removal and reassembly time.

Acceptance test

Use normal production blocks and report good kg/h, dimensional distribution, fines, smear, temperature rise, operator count, cleaning time, alarm response and restart consistency.

QD-300 automatic dicer FAQ

Is QD-300 a smaller QD-420?

No. They have different architectures and operating envelopes. QD-300 focuses on prepared blocks up to 35 mm thick and 1–30 mm cuts at higher cycle speed.

Does 0.1 mm accuracy guarantee every meat piece?

No. It is a published machine accuracy figure. Finished-product variation also depends on temperature, compression, geometry, blade condition and feeding.

Can QD-300 cut fully hard-frozen meat below -8°C?

The exact page specifies -8°C to 0°C. Colder duty requires factory approval and a representative-product test; it should not be assumed.

Engineering selection guide

Specify Automatic Frozen Meat Dicer from the finished product backwards

A reliable quotation starts with the product and process target rather than a catalogue capacity alone. Provide incoming product temperature, block dimensions, cut geometry, blade configuration, loading method and downstream handling. Samples, drawings and representative raw materials allow the supplier to identify the working configuration and any limits that should appear in the signed specification.

Published capacity is a reference condition, not an unconditional guarantee for every recipe. Sustainable performance must be measured as accepted product after normal rejects and interruptions. The acceptance plan should record cut-size distribution, fines, smearing, product temperature rise, yield and accepted kilograms per hour. Agree the run duration, staffing, utility conditions and sampling frequency before the factory acceptance test so both parties evaluate the same result.

Factory integration

Confirm voltage and frequency, connected load, compressed air, water, drainage, exhaust or refrigeration where applicable. Check loading height, discharge direction, service clearance, floor loading and the real interface with upstream and downstream equipment.

Hygiene and changeover

Review blade access, trapped product, safe lockout, removable guards and sanitation verification. The sanitation method must suit the machine’s electrical protection and the factory’s documented food-safety program.

FAT and site acceptance

Use the intended material and product format. Record start-up loss, stable output, quality variation, alarms, downtime, cleaning time and changeover time. Repeat critical checks after installation with actual site utilities and trained operators.
